

Funeral services to celebrate the life of Mary L. Schnoor, 92, of Davenport will be held at 10:30 a.m. on Friday, November 8, 2019 at the Cunnick-Collins Mortuary Chapel in Davenport. Burial will follow at Davenport Memorial Park Cemetery. The family will greet friends from 9:30 a.m. until service time at the mortuary. Mrs. Schnoor died on Sunday, November 3, 2019 at Ridgecrest Village in Davenport.
Mary Louise Rauch was born on October 19, 1927 in Davenport, IA, the daughter of Irwin and Edna (Willers) Rauch. After graduating from Davenport High School she began work as a secretary for the Davenport school system. After taking time off to raise her family she returned to the school system and retired in 1988. On January 29, 1949 she married Kenneth W. Schnoor at Zion Lutheran Church in Davenport. He preceded her in death in January of 1992.
Mary was a long time and active member of Zion Lutheran Church in Davenport. She was an avid reader and her life was filled with dancing, travel, and card clubs.
She is survived by - her children: Nancy (Reid) Odean of Rock Island, Kathleen (Jeff) Ward of Blue Grass, and James Schnoor of Davenport; her Grandchildren: Kelly (Cory) Shook, Patrick Schnoor, Kelsey Lighton, and Rebecca Ward; Great-Granddaughters: Addison Shook, Lilly Shook, and Livy Lighton; a Sister: Joann (Melvin) Oberhous of Davenport and many nieces and nephews.
She was preceded in death by her parents and a brother, Irwin 'Bud' Rauch, and a Daughter-in-law, Pamela K. Schnoor.
Memorials may be made to Zion Lutheran Church in Davenport or the Scott County Humane Society.
The family wishes to extend a special note of thanks to the nurses and staff of Genesis Hospice and Ridgecrest Village.
